NOIR BY NOIR-WEST presents new short fiction by 30 of Ireland’s best established and emerging writers; stories filled with menace and intrigue, with wit, wind and rain.For all the details, clickety-click here …
From small town streets in millennium Ireland to the frontline trenches of World War 1, these stories represent a new departure in Irish literature, with contributions by Galway writers including: Mike McCormack, Órfhlaith Foyle, Ken Bruen, Geraldine Mills, Kernan Andrews, Cristina Galvin, Des Kenny and Celia de Fréine.
